XPS Foam Panels for Thermal Packaging Solutions

From fresh food and beverages to pharmaceuticals and specialty chemicals, maintaining the right temperature during storage and transit can make or break product quality. One material that is proving to be highly effective in this field is XPS foam panels.

Applications in Thermal Packaging

1. Food and Beverage Industry

XPS panels are used to line shipping containers and boxes for fresh produce, seafood, dairy, and frozen goods. They help preserve freshness from farm to table.

2. Pharmaceuticals and Healthcare

For vaccines, biologics, and temperature-sensitive medications, XPS panels provide reliable thermal protection during transport. Their consistent insulation performance helps maintain cold-chain integrity.

3. E-Commerce and Meal Delivery

With the rise of online grocery and meal-kit services, XPS foam panels are used in reusable and disposable boxes to ensure customers receive products in safe and optimal condition.

4. Industrial Chemicals

Certain specialty chemicals and adhesives require stable temperatures during storage and shipping. XPS panels help prevent fluctuations that could affect product quality.

Key Advantages

Lightweight – Reduces overall shipping weight and costs.
Moisture Resistant – Prevents water absorption, ensuring long-lasting insulation.
Durable – Withstands compression and repeated use.
Customizable – Panels can be cut and shaped to fit various packaging designs.

Toward Sustainable Packaging

While polystyrene-based materials face environmental challenges, innovations are underway to make XPS foam panels more sustainable. Options include recycling programs, reusable panel systems, and integration with biodegradable outer packaging to reduce waste.
